GRAND RAPIDS, MI, April 17, 2023— Crain Communications today launched ޾ֲ’s Grand Rapids Business ().

The media brand will provide thousands of readers with timely, in-depth and contextual news and information about West Michigan business.

In addition, ޾ֲ’s Grand Rapids Business will expand its reach into the community with a full slate of live events that help business leaders and community members engage and network in meaningful ways.

޾ֲ’s Grand Rapids Business was created from the consolidation of the Grand Rapids Business Journal and MiBiz, both of which Crain Communications acquired in 2022.

“When we entered the West Michigan market with the acquisitions last year, we said we were committed to giving readers and business partners the most comprehensive news and information about the Grand Rapids region,” said KC ޾ֲ, president and CEO of Crain Communications. “Today is a special day in that we formally launch the new ޾ֲ’s Grand Rapids Business brand to deliver on that promise.”

The expansion into Grand Rapids marks ޾ֲ’s fifth city brand, serving alongside ޾ֲ’s Detroit Business, ޾ֲ’s Chicago Business, ޾ֲ’s New York Business and ޾ֲ’s Cleveland Business.

While the Grand Rapids news team will provide comprehensive coverage of the market, strong emphasis will be placed on the topics of real estate, health care, manufacturing, finance, technology, law and the food industry.

“The news team we have assembled in Grand Rapids is spectacular and I’m excited for our readers to see the stories they deliver,” said Mickey Ciokajlo, executive editor of ޾ֲ’s Grand Rapids Business and ޾ֲ’s Detroit Business. “This team has deep roots and vast connections in West Michigan, which is so important in local journalism today.”

The news team is led by Editor Joe Boomgaard, who previously served as editor of MiBiz. Working alongside Boomgaard are Managing Editor Andy Balaskovitz, who held the same title at MiBiz, and Special Projects Editor Tim Gortsema, who previously was editor of the Grand Rapids Business Journal.

Jill May will oversee the sales operation as director of sales and events, reporting to Lisa Rudy, publisher of ޾ֲ’s Grand Rapids Business. May previously oversaw sales for the Grand Rapids Business Journal. Matthew Chaffee, who was the marketing coordinator at the Business Journal, will serve as events and marketing coordinator.

About Crain Communications
Crain Communications is a privately held media company that produces trusted and relevant news across digital platforms, publications, lead generation, research and data products, digital platforms, custom publishing, and events with uncompromising integrity. Reaching 78 million readers globally, the company’s portfolio consists of 24 brands. Many of ޾ֲ’s brands are the most influential media properties in the verticals they serve including Automotive News, Ad Age, Modern Healthcare, Plastics News, and Pensions & Investments. Headquartered in Detroit, the company has 700+ employees in nine locations delivering exceptional news content over a variety of platforms to empower the success of its readers and clients.
